## Runbook: Inkwell Markdown Pipeline — Release Checks

Before tagging a release of the Inkwell rendering pipeline, confirm the renderer cache is warm and the document index has finished its nightly rebuild. If render latency exceeds two seconds on the canary set, roll back the sanitizer stage first. All verification queries run against the pipeline's metadata database; the release manager should run them from the bastion host. Connect using the connection string below.

primary connection of yagep-kahip = redis://giliel_svc:zYiKsLL2PLpfPL@db-348f.xolmarsys.corp:5432/fenwyn

Subject: Handover — pinning policy DB

Welcome aboard. Short version: all dependency pins for Larkwood services live in one table, `pin_registry`. Never edit pins in repo manifests; CI overwrites them from the registry nightly. Exceptions need a row in `pin_waivers` with an expiry date. To review or add pins, connect with the string below.

warehouse DSN: mssql://rusdor_svc:0FSWCn9@db-951a.paliqforge.local:5432/ulawyn

TURN-208: Gatevale turnstile counters at the Merrow Field pilot double-count when a rotation reverses mid-cycle. Attendance totals drift roughly 2% high per event. The debounce window fix is implemented, reviewed by Ilsa, and soak-tested across two simulated match days without drift. Ready for your cut; the candidate build is identified below.

trace token, tagag-tafog: htk6_5ed18c

**Key ceremony checklist — item 7 (Hollowpine sync)**

☐ Before rotating the signing keys, confirm the session-token refresh bug in Driftgate is patched; otherwise fresh tokens invalidate mid-ceremony and the quorum must restart. Verify the patched build is deployed to both witnesses. Then unseal the ceremony vault using the recovery passphrase recorded immediately below.

recovery phrase for fajep-yaweg: gilath-sorox-wenius-rusdor-keliel-zorius